What Exactly is “Wiki Loves the olympics”?
Think of it as a global scavenger hunt for sports history, powered by Wikipedia and its sister projects. During the Rio 2016 Games, photographers, writers, and sports fans were encouraged to contribute their images, articles, and knowledge about Olympic athletes, venues, and moments to Wikimedia Commons and Wikipedia. The goal? To enrich the world’s largest online encyclopedia with high-quality, freely licensed content, ensuring that the legacy of these amazing Games would be preserved and accessible for generations to come.
This initiative, as highlighted by the licensing data, operates under a Creative Commons Attribution-Share Alike 4.0 international License (CC BY-SA 4.0). this means anyone can use, share, and adapt the content, provided that they give credit to the original creator and share any new creations under the same license. It’s a powerful model for democratizing knowledge and fostering a vibrant community of contributors.

For years, coaches relied on gut instinct and years of experience. While that intuition remains invaluable, it’s now augmented by a torrent of information. Think of it like this: a seasoned baseball scout might have a keen eye for a pitcher’s mechanics, but data analytics can quantify that pitcher’s spin rate, velocity drop, and pitch sequencing with pinpoint accuracy. This isn’t about replacing human expertise; it’s about empowering it with an unprecedented level of detail.
The Athlete’s Edge: Precision Training and Injury prevention
At the forefront of this data-driven shift are the athletes themselves. Wearable technology, once a novelty, is now standard issue for many professionals. These devices, from smartwatches to specialized compression gear, capture a wealth of physiological data: heart rate variability, sleep patterns, muscle activation, and even the impact forces an athlete endures.
“It’s like having a personal doctor and performance coach with you 24/7,” explains Dr. Anya sharma, a sports physiologist who has worked with several NFL teams. “We can identify subtle signs of fatigue before an athlete even feels it, allowing us to adjust training loads and prevent injuries that could sideline them for months. This is a game-changer, especially in high-impact sports like football and basketball.”
Consider the case of a star quarterback. Data analytics can track his throwing motion, identifying minute inefficiencies that, over time, could lead to shoulder strain. By analyzing this data, trainers can implement targeted exercises to correct these issues, extending the athlete’s career and maintaining peak performance. This proactive approach is a far cry from the reactive “wait until they’re hurt” model of the past.

The Unseen Grind: What It Takes to Compete
Think of the precision required in a tennis serve, combined with the agility of a basketball player and the strategic foresight of a chess grandmaster. That’s badminton in a nutshell.The shuttlecock, traveling at speeds exceeding 300 miles per hour, demands split-second decision-making. For American athletes, this often means training in facilities that may not have the same resources as their international counterparts, yet they push forward with an unwavering commitment.
“It’s a constant battle to balance training with everyday life,” explains a former collegiate badminton standout, who wished to remain anonymous to focus on current players. “Many of us are juggling jobs or studies, and the financial commitment to travel and compete internationally is immense. But the love for the game, the thrill of a perfectly executed smash, that’s what keeps you going.”
This dedication is precisely what makes the pursuit of American badminton excellence so compelling. It’s a testament to the raw passion for the sport, a spirit that mirrors the underdog narratives we often celebrate in American athletics.
Beyond the Court: The Strategic Chess Match
Badminton isn’t just about brute force; it’s a game of angles, deception, and exploiting weaknesses. A well-placed drop shot can leave an opponent scrambling, while a powerful clear can push them to the back of the court, opening up opportunities for a devastating smash.
Consider the tactical battles seen in other sports. It’s akin to a quarterback reading a defense, or a baseball manager making a crucial pitching change.In badminton, players are constantly analyzing their opponent’s stance, their grip on the racket, and their tendencies.This mental fortitude is as crucial as any physical attribute.
